Stop A Divorce In Its Tracks With These Tips


Many people find themselves in the devastating position where they are faced with a spouse who is requesting a divorce. If your spouse is asking for a divorce and you want to find a way to salvage the marriage and stop a divorce from taking place, then you will need to take some time to really evaluate the relationship.

While there are certainly many different reasons why one person in the relationship may be looking for a separation or divorce, it is important to realize that even if an affair or other person has entered into the dynamics of your marriage, there is still hope. You can stop a divorce at any time and reconcile your marriage if that is what both parties want.

The first thing you should do when confronted with the news that your spouse wants a divorce is to refrain from overreacting. You do not want to start begging, pleading, name calling or belittling; none of these actions is going to get you any closer to your hope of fixing the relationship and saving the marriage. It can be hard not to get too emotional, but you need to take a step back and look at the marriage for what it really is. Chances are there are things that you have said or done that have contributed to the breakdown of the marriage and those are the things you will need to work on and take responsibility for. However, this is not the time to point out all the faults your partner has, especially if your intention is to stop a divorce from occurring.


Your partner is probably seeking a divorce because they feel that they have lost their love for you, or they think the problems in the relationship are so big that they will not be able to overcome them. No one wants to spend their life living in a relationship where they are unhappy. So, you will need to find the areas that you can change in yourself and concentrate on that, not on your partner and their faults. It's not that your partner has no faults or has not contributed to the breakdown of the marriage; it is just that you will need to step back and give it some time before those issues are addressed.

Where there was once love, this feeling can be restored. Sometimes we think we have fallen out of love because we no longer have those intense feelings we once had. We have slipped into a complacent way of living and the rut of going to work, doing chores, taking care of the kids, paying bills and all the other routine necessities of life have left you not showing the kind of care and compassion that you did in the beginning. If you can, try to show your spouse small acts of kindness. Do not push them into changing their mind, but you can apologize for the things you have done in the marriage and let them know that you intend to change. Then, do it. Start working on making those changes immediately and don't throw it in your spouse's face, let them see your new attitude and behavior rather than speaking about it. They will notice.

When you hear that your spouse wants to leave the relationship, or wants a divorce, it can be devastating. Remember, there are things you can do to help resurrect that marriage; but you need to not push your spouse further away.
